The invention discloses a transcriptional repression domain, its coding gene and its application in regulating plant stress tolerance. The amino acid sequence shown. Because the existing SRDX transcription repression activity is too strong, it may cause some transcription factor fusion SRDX transgenic plants can not survive, compared with this, the repression sequence of the present invention has transcription repression activity, but its activity is lower than SRDX, which is useful for exploring transcription Factor function and gene expression regulation have great scientific research and practical value.

[0001] The invention relates to the technical field of bioengineering, in particular to a transcriptional repression domain sEAR and its coding gene and its application in regulating the expression of downstream target genes by transcription factors. Background technique

[0002] Plants develop from a seed to a complete plant, and each growth stage is always accompanied by gene expression and silencing. The dicot Arabidopsis thaliana is an important model plant that can be used to explore the regulation of gene expression. The theoretical research on gene expression regulation provides an important theoretical basis for improving the yield, quality and stress resistance of crops.
